Decreasing overgrown plants is a critical aspect of landscape management, assisting to restore order, enhance looks,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can limit airflow, reduce sunlight penetration, and produce chances for pests and disease. Pruning and thinning are the primary approaches for managing dense or unruly plants, permitting plants to thrive while preserving a controlled look. The process involves selectively removing excess branches, stems, and foliage, always considering the natural development habit of each species. Timing is vital; some plants react best to pruning throughout dormancy, while blooming varieties may require post-bloom cutting to maintain blooms. Proper strategy guarantees cuts are clean and positioned to motivate healthy new development. In addition to improving plant health, decreasing overgrowth improves availability and exposure in the landscape Pathways, driveways, and outside home end up being much safer and more welcoming. Long-lasting maintenance strategies prevent future overgrowth, making sure a balanced and unified landscape.
